To walk through the historic centre of Finestrat is to enter a picture adorned with colourful houses and charming squares that dot the streets here and there. If the walk is in winter, the current season, the traveller will be impregnated with a bucolic feeling that will be exacerbated on cold days, when the chimneys leave the smell of burnt wood in the air. Smell will undoubtedly be the sense that will allow the tourist to enter into not so ancient times, in which the rural world had not yet said goodbye as a way of life in this beautiful municipality of the Marina Baixa.
There are many ways to wander and get lost in these little streets. Perhaps a very flirtatious way to do it is to get to know them having as a point of reference the small squares that are scattered throughout the historic center. You can start with the largest, the Plaça de la Unió Europea, at the entrance to the town centre and just above the underground car park. This huge rectangle is the place chosen for the big events that are organized in Finestrat, from the Christmas Market to the sporting events that attract hundreds of people.
Continuing along Carrer Nou, you will reach Plaça del Poble, the nerve centre of the old town of Finestrat, as both the Town Hall and the Church of Sant Bertomeu are just a few metres away. A short distance from here and almost unnoticed, is La Placeta, a small and branching point to access different streets and, among them, the one that leads to the most recently created square, that of the old Town Hall, which was designed as a result of demolishing the old town hall.
It is possible to reach La Placeta by another route, having in common the starting point: La Plaça del Poble. However, this time, the main entrance of the Church is taken as a reference, with its staircases, which lead directly to La Torreta, one of the most picturesque and Mediterranean squares in Finestrat. If we retrace our steps, and cross Carrer Nou again, we reach La Fonteta, which is a small square that is right on the main road, where the traveller can make a stop on the way to regain strength and taste the local cuisine offered by the different bars and restaurants.
